Root and maybe Stokes aside, agreed about no England player being good enough KM. But it should be all overseas players, not just Aussies. It won't ever happen because of £, but I don't see many overseas players turning out for domestic teams outside of England over the years. In some ways we are our own worst enemy. An overseas player may well bring skills and knowledge, but their personal benefit far outweighs that in my opinion. Perhaps the county championship should be reduced in size, make it regional and play it on true wickets in the middle of summer. A failure in county cricket is often overlooked as there is always another game straight after to make amends. In Sheffield Shield there are only a few games to play all season, the competition is way harder, and there is a genuine price on your wicket.
